Output 25bdda5c427470e196065f84d20fb51ca3abb6b7650f4852830c861cdcf0d8b4:0

value
1287900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d62ddc72da1edf34057cd98f3bf75bc33583621e OP_EQUAL
address
3MDVU5jfeJqFxesxvQ3keXLbBAcEc5ZMuL
transaction
25bdda5c427470e196065f84d20fb51ca3abb6b7650f4852830c861cdcf0d8b4
spent
true